See the instructions on Docker Hub for information on running this container. Nightly snapshot builds generated from the head of the master branch are available. The open source software ecosystem around PostgreSQL is as robust as the database itself, but sometimes it can be hard for people new to PostgreSQL, and even some seasoned veterans, to get all of the software dependencies for their development environment setup on their computers. Run the container using the below command. Connecting pgadmin to postgres in.
The default configuration is not intended for production use (it runs in desktop mode, so authentication is disabled). Pgadmin fails to connect to localhost, but psql works from outside docker. If not added explicitly they will be part of the default bridge network.
The Docker Daemon runs in a virtual machine on OS X, which means you actually need to connect to that IP address (rather than localhost). To find that IP address, type the following: docker -machine ip default. The IP you get back will tell you the IP to connect to. LTS , but each time I create a container it crashes.
How is Docker different from a virtual machine? Should I use Vagrant or Docker for creating an isolated. This image expects a number of environment variables to be set. Admin PostgreSQL Tools.
It is a web-based tool. Just make sure the postgres container is running as well. The PostgreSQL object-relational database system provides reliability and data integrity. This variable is required and must be set at launch time. PGADMIN _DEFAULT_PASSWORD.
Docker -compose can be used to easily automate multi-container deployments. One of the most challenging tasks while running such deployments is separating data from software. While containers are ephemeral, user data needs to persist. A classic example, of this is when we try and run database container images.
Instead of worrying about downloading, installing and configuring database. You can quickly spin a container do your testing and. GitHub Gist: instantly share code, notes, and snippets.
The project includes an optional Docker Swarm stack. The stack will create a set of three Docker containers, including a local copy of PostgreSQL 11. Builds for Windows and macOS are available now, along with a Python Wheel, Docker Container and source code tarball from the download area. Laradock is a full PHP development environment based on Docker. Supporting a variety of common services, all pre-configured to provide a full PHP development environment.
It provides a visual, user-friendly environment with a host of practical solutions that make managing databases easy. If you don’t specify a name, it will be generated out of two randomly selected words separated by an underscore. Replication is a crucial part of every modern infrastructure these days and with scalability in mind it plays an important role on delivering high quality.
Under db for the database we want the Docker image for Postgres 10. Compose where the container should be located in our Docker container. For web we’re specifying how the web service will run. First Compose needs to build an image from the current directory,.
The ELK stack will be used for collecting logs from the PostgreSQL instance. Dockerize PostgreSQL Estimated reading time: minutes Install PostgreSQL on Docker. Assuming there is no Docker image that suits your needs on the Docker Hub, you can create one yourself. Note: This exposes the FastCGI socket to the Internet. Make sure to add proper firewall rules or use a private Docker network instead to prevent a direct access.
A named volume called pgdata is also defined in the following command. The container is called postgres-server.
Geen opmerkingen:
Een reactie posten
Opmerking: Alleen leden van deze blog kunnen een reactie posten.